So there was some luck involved here, I know you're supposed to call about 30-60 minutes for bears, but I was a little winded at 30 minutes, so I stopped. We stood up, and I hear, "Hey, there's one right there!" He was a couple hundred yards above us in the wide open looking very intently for his dinner! But he got lead instead! Great learning experience I hope to do again soon! And thanks Bango, your photos and encouragement on this subject have been a great motivation.

Sounds like he was playing it cautious. Wonder how many times ive had bears or cats coming in real careful and i gave up too early. Hard to stay confident and keep going after calling for 30 or 40 minutes and not getting any action. Im sure ive probably screwed up by bailing on sets too soon.
